php字符串怎么去掉“-”字符
时间 : 2023-02-16 09:40: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
PHP字符串去掉“-”字符是一个常见的处理任务,它可以使用字符串处理函数str_replace()来实现。
str_replace()函数是PHP中常用的字符串处理函数,它可以替换字符串中的某个字符串,可用于PHP字符串去掉“-”字符。该函数的使用格式为:
str_replace (search,replace,subject,replace_count);
其中search是要被替换的字符串,replace是要替换为的字符串,subject是被处理的字符串,而replace_count变量的值为被替换的总次数。
因此,要去掉一个字符串中的“-”只需要调用str_replace()函数即可:
$newstring=str_replace("-","",$string);
其中$string要被处理的字符串,$newstring为处理之后的新字符串。因此只需一句简单的代码就可以实现PHP字符串去掉“-”字符的操作。
另外,还可以使用PHP中的正则表达式来实现去掉字符串中的“-”字符,可以使用preg_replace()函数实现。它使用格式为:
preg_replace(pattern,replacement,subject,limit,count);
其中pattern是一个正则表达式,replacement是替换字符,subject则是要被处理的字符串,而limit和count则是限制替换字符的次数。
要去掉字符串中的“-”符号,可以使用如下表达式:
$newstring=preg_replace("/-/","",$string);
其中$string为要被处理的字符串,$newstring为处理之后的新字符串。而且,preg_replace()支持更复杂的格式字符串处理,可用于更复杂的字符串替换工作。
总之,要实现PHP字符串去掉“-”字符,可以使用str_replace()或preg_replace()函数,根据自己需要
PHP字符串是在当今web开发中广泛使用的数据类型,其中也有许多操作字符串的方法,其中之一就是去掉字符串中的“-”字符。
下面介绍三种非常常见的去掉字符串中“-”字符的方法:
1、使用PHP自带的函数str_replace()实现:
这是一个替换字符串中某个字符的内置函数,使用方法:str_replace($search, $replace, $subject),其中$search是要搜索的字符,$replace是替换的字符,$subject是要操作的字符串。这里我们可以使用这样的方法来去掉“-”字符:
str_replace("-", "", $str);
2、使用strtr()实现:
strtr()是一个有用的字符串替换函数,使用方法: strtr($str, $replace),其中$replace是一个或者多个不同的替换字符,可以使用:strtr($str, "-=>")来去掉字符串中的“-”字符;
3、使用正则表达式实现:
使用正则表达式是另一种常用的去掉“-”字符的方法,使用方法: preg_replace('/-/', '',$str),其中'/ - /'是定义的正则表达式,用于匹配字符串中的“-”字符,可以将其去掉。
以上就是PHP字符串怎样去掉“-”字符的三种常用方法,这三种方法都可以广泛使用。正确对待字符串操作,可以有效提高代码效率,使代码更加易读、易维护。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章